Job Title: Warehouse Associate / Forklift Operator Job Description
This role performs a full range of shipping and receiving activities in a modern warehouse environment, including unloading and loading trucks, stocking and put-away, pallet preparation, and inventory tracking. You will use RF scanners, paper pick lists, and a warehouse management system to manage inventory, while safely operating sit-down and stand-up forklifts and a cherry picker at heights of 20-30 feet to pick product.
Responsibilities
Perform shipping and receiving functions, including unloading and loading trucks in a safe and efficient manner.
Break down pallets, refill packages and boxes, and prepare outbound shipments.
Wrap pallets and ensure they are securely prepared and labeled prior to shipment.
Stock and put away product in designated locations while maintaining accurate inventory records.
Utilize RF scanners and paper pick lists to locate, pick, and track inventory.
Operate sit-down and stand-up forklifts, as well as a cherry picker reaching 20-30 feet, to pick and move product.
Conduct inventory control activities such as cycle counts and inventory adjustments as needed.
Navigate the warehouse management system (SAP) to transfer inventory between locations and execute required commands.
Handle materials safely, including lifting up to 50 lbs occasionally and 25 lbs repeatedly.
Maintain a clean, organized, and safe work area in accordance with warehouse standards and procedures.
